Baked Ravioli
Description
Baked Ravioli assembles layers of frozen cheese ravioli with a homemade meat sauce made from browned ground beef, diced onions, garlic, marinara sauce, tomato sauce, and dried oregano. This layered casserole is topped with shredded mozzarella and grated Parmesan cheese to create a rich, cheesy finish.
The recipe cooks the frozen ravioli directly in the oven without prior boiling, making the process more straightforward and saving time. Covering the dish with foil during the initial baking stage ensures even cooking and prevents drying out, followed by uncovered baking to brown and bubble the cheese topping. The result is a hearty baked pasta dish with tender ravioli enveloped in a savory meat sauce and melted cheese.
Baked Ravioli works as a family-style main dish and can be divided into smaller portions or frozen for later use. It stores well refrigerated for a few days and can be reheated, making it convenient for meal planning or leftovers.
The seasoning includes dried oregano for herbal notes, while the combination of two tomato sauces enriches the sauce base with depth and acidity.
Ingredients
- 1 pound ground beef
- ½ onion diced, medium
- 3 cloves garlic minced
- 24 ounces marinara sauce jar
- 15 ounces tomato sauce
- 1 teaspoon oregano dried
- 25 ounce cheese ravioli frozen, package
- 2 cups mozzarella cheese shredded
- ¼ cup Parmesan Cheese grated
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Spray a 9 x 13’’ inch baking dish (or two 8-inch dishes with cooking spray) set aside.
- In a large skillet over medium heat brown the ground beef and diced onions. During the last minute of cooking add the minced garlic. When ground beef is cooked through drain grease off.
- In a mixing bowl combine the cooked ground beef, marinara sauce, tomato sauce and oregano. Spread a thin layer of this mixture across the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
- Arrange half of the frozen ravioli in a single layer over the sauce in the baking dish.
- Top with half of the remaining marinara sauce mixture and half of the shredded Mozzarella cheese.
- Repeat layers then sprinkle Parmesan cheese on top.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il.
- Place the baking dish in a preheated oven and bake for 25 minutes. Remove foil from the baking dish and cook for an additional 25 minutes or until bubbly and hot in the center.
- Remove from the oven and let stand for 10 minutes before serving.
Notes
- Frozen ravioli can be baked directly without boiling, simplifying preparation.
- You can make this casserole ahead and freeze it up to two months before baking.
- Dividing the recipe into smaller pans allows for frozen portions or more convenient serving sizes.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for two to three days.
